NEW YORK, NY - January 27, 2023 - Today, BET announced its new four-part, eight-hour documentary film series from Emmy Award©-winning Executive Producer Stanley Nelson and Firelight Films. The groundbreaking BET original franchise, "Black + Iconic" celebrates Black cultural icons, pioneers, and activists and their impact, influence and legacies in fashion, music, film, and dance. "Black + Iconic" examines of the momentous achievements of Black people across various fields while celebrating the power of Black cultural innovators. Executive producers Connie Orlando and Jason Samuels developed "Black + Iconic" for BET, along with senior supervising producer Steven Ramey.

Directed by Lynne Robinson, the inaugural film in the series, "Black X Iconic: Style Gods," has signed on Emmy(R), Tony(R), and Grammy(R) Award-winning and Golden Globe(R)-nominated actor, singer, director, producer and activist Billy Porter to narrate, host, and serve as executive producer for the groundbreaking doc. "Black + Iconic: Style Gods" premieres on Saturday, February 18 at 8 PM ET/PT on BET, BET Her, BET+, and VH1.

Following in the footsteps of previous award-winning BET original documentaries "ALI: The People's Champ" and "Katrina 10 Years Later: Through Hell and High Water," the first project in the franchise kicks off with a two-hour film on fashion. Weaving dazzling archival footage and original interviews with legendary Black models, fashion designers, and style icons, "Black + Iconic: Style Gods" explores the myriad of ways Black people have overcome racism to ultimately blaze an undeniable trail from the streets through the most exclusive runways of high fashion.

About Stanley Nelson

Stanley Nelson is the foremost chronicler of the African American experience working in nonfiction film today. His documentary films, many of which have aired on PBS, combine compelling narratives with rich and deeply- researched historical detail, shining new light on both familiar and under-explored aspects of the American past. A MacArthur "Genius" Fellow, Nelson was awarded a Peabody in 2016 for his body of work . He has received numerous honors over the course of his career, including the 2016 Lifetime Achievement Award from the National Academy of Television Arts Sciences. In 2013, President Barack Obama presented Nelson with the National Medal in the Humanities.

About Firelight Films

Founded by award-winning filmmaker Stanley Nelson, Firelight Films produces documentaries by and about communities of color. Firelight Films productions have garnered multiple Primetime Emmy, Peabody, IDA, and Sundance awards. Among them are the feature films "Becoming Frederick Douglass" and "Harriet Tubman: Visions of Freedom"; "Attica," which was nominated for an Academy Award; "Tulsa Burning: The 1921 Race Massacre"; "Crack: Cocaine, Corruption & Conspiracy"; "Miles Davis: Birth of the Cool"; "The Black Panthers: Vanguard of the Revolution"; "The Murder of Emmett Till"; and "The Black Press: Soldiers Without Swords." Firelight Films has also produced notable short films including, "The Story of Access," which was commissioned by Starbucks in 2017 for a mandatory anti-bias employee training program, and "Commemorate and Celebrate Freedom," commissioned by the Smithsonian's National Museum of African American History and Culture for its opening night in 2015. Upcoming Firelight Films productions include "Sound of the Police" for ABC News Studios and "Creating the New World: The Transatlantic Slave Trade," a four-part documentary series for PBS.

About Billy Porter

Billy Porter is an award-winning actor, singer, director, producer, composer, and playwright. He won the Emmy Award for Lead Actor for his appearance in FX's Emmy- and Golden Globe-nominated drama Pose and earned three Emmy nominations total for his role in the series. A Hollywood Walk of Fame inductee, Porter has numerous theater credits, including the role of "Lola" in the Broadway musical Kinky Boots, which he originated in 2013 and for which he won the Tony, Drama Desk, and Outer Critics Circle awards, as well as the Grammy for best musical-theat er album. He won his second Tony Award in 2022 for "Best Musical" as a producer on A Strange Loop. Recently, Porter appeared in the third season of FX's Pose, Amazon's Cinderella re-make, the second season of CBS All Access' The Twilight Zone, American Horror Story: Apocalypse, and narrated HBO Max's Equal. Upcoming, he will star in Our Son alongside Luke Evans, direct a queer teen comedy from Gabrielle Union's I'll Have Another Productions titled To Be Real, and star in the Paramount comedy 80 For Brady alongside Jane Fonda, Rita Moreno, Lily Tomlin, and Sally Field. He also recently directed an episode of Fox's forthcoming anthology series Accused. His feature directorial debut "Anything's Possible," a coming-of age film written by Ximena García Lecuona, was released in July 2022 on Prime Video. Porter released his first literary project, Unprotected, in October 2021, which was published by Abrams Press. As a recording artist, Porter most recently released his single "Stranger Things" under his record deal with Island Records (UK) and Republic Records (US).
